Choosing the Receive Mode
There are four different Receive Modes for your machine. You can 
choose the mode that best suits your needs.
* In
Fax/Tel
mode you must set the Ring Delay and F/T Ring Time.
Setup Receive
LCD
How it works
When to use it
Fax Only
(automatic receive)
The machine 
automatically answers 
every call as a fax.
For dedicated fax lines.
Fax/Tel
*
(fax and telephone)
(with an external or 
extension telephone)
The machine controls the 
line and automatically 
answers every call. If the 
call is a fax it will receive 
the fax. If the call is not a 
fax it will ring 
(pseudo/double ring) for 
you to pick up the call.
Use this mode if you expect to receive lots of fax 
messages and few telephone calls. You cannot 
have an answering machine on the same line, even 
if it is on a separate wall socket/phone socket on 
the same line. You cannot use the telephone 
company’s Voice Mail in this mode.
External TAD
(with an external 
answering machine)
The external answering 
machine (TAD) 
automatically answers 
every call. 
Voice messages are 
stored on the external 
TAD. Fax messages are 
printed.
Use this mode if you have connected an answering 
machine on your phone line.
The TAD setting works only with an external 
answering machine. Ring Delay and F/T Ring Time 
do not work in this setting.
Manual
(manual receive)
(with an external or 
extension telephone)
You control the phone 
line and must answer 
every call yourself.
Use this mode when you are using a computer 
modem on the same line or if you don’t receive 
many fax messages or with Distinctive Ring.
If you answer and hear fax tones, wait until the 
machine takes over the call, then hang up. (See 
Fax Detect on page 5-5.)
